Alabaster Crimsoneye Snake
The Alabaster Crimsoneye Snake, later named Scarlett, is an Earth-born venomous monster whose meeting with Jake Thayne redirects her rapid growth toward the Malefic Viper's Order.
Biography
The Grand Mangrove and the wider multiverse
Scarlett first rises from the Grand Mangrove River as a mid-tier C-grade, kills the frog threatening Jake's party, and questions how a human can walk her Forefather's Path. Jake's Blessing transforms suspicion into intense loyalty, after which she escorts him, Carmen, and Sylphie through the river and resolves to grow beyond its restrictions. When she later protects Miranda Wells, her ignorance of human norms makes her dangerously brutal; Miranda teaches her restraint, helps give her the name Scarlett, and guides her toward the Order. There Scarlett refines multiple venoms, earns an upgraded Blessing directly from the Viper, and ultimately reaches B-grade as a Jadescale Crimsoneye Snake, using near-unnoticed venom to eliminate a B-grade enemy while remaining an ally of Earth. (Chapters 457–459, 533–540, 565, 629, 1158, and 1169)
Appearance and personality
In snake form, Scarlett begins as a slender, approximately thirty-meter-long white snake with gemlike red eyes and a head only around the size of Jake's torso. Her humanoid form resembles a young woman with snow-white skin, scattered scales, long white hair, red reptilian eyes, and a snakeskin-like dress; after B-grade she retains sickly pale skin and entirely red eyes. She is initially formal but socially adolescent, eager for praise, fiercely loyal, and capable of killing without hesitation. Training and friendship make her more sociable, not less dangerous. (Chapters 457–458, 533–540, and 1158)
Path, class, and abilities
Scarlett is a monster whose Path centers on innate venom, the Crimsoneye lineage, and the Malefic Viper's Blessing. A natural treasure accelerates her early C-grade growth but temporarily binds her to the Grand Mangrove region while it is digested. She develops a humanoid form unusually quickly, joins the Order, and later evolves from Alabaster to Jadescale Crimsoneye Snake in B-grade. (Chapters 458, 533–540, and 1158)
- Venom cultivation: Her original venom is potent enough that Jake doubts his Palate can protect him even at equal grade. At the Order she cultivates necrotic and hemotoxin venoms, then develops paralysis toxins and venoms that disrupt energy flow and mana control. Delivering venom remains easiest through a bite or unseen puncture, and mutual venom exchange grants resistance, meaning disclosure to another snake carries both tactical and cultural consequences. (Chapters 457, 629, and 1149)
- Speed, stealth, and killing force: Scarlett kills the frog within seconds, later decapitates a human too quickly for Miranda to follow, and as a B-grade poisons a Warchief through unnoticed ankle punctures. She can hide well enough to appear from a shimmer and has physical force sufficient to launch Draskil across kilometers, but the corpus does not name the stealth or striking skills responsible. (Chapters 457, 534, and 1158)
- Polymorph and monster command: Her C-grade Polymorph creates a functional humanoid body after intensive study, while other C-grade snakes obey her leadership in the Mangrove. Early use is technically advanced but morally crude; Miranda has to teach her that coercion, dissection, and killing are unacceptable means of learning human society. (Chapters 533–540)
Her Greater Blessing is upgraded by the Malefic Viper after her prior blessing's Record capacity is exhausted. The latest evidence shows her alive in B-grade with mature venom specialization, although her full new racial skill set is not disclosed. (Chapters 629, 1158, and 1169)
Relationships
- Jake Thayne: Jake proves his connection to the Viper by blessing Scarlett, gives her guidance about freedom and self-improvement, and helps name her. She responds with intense loyalty and trust, later joining his wider factional world while seeking exchanges that advance both of their venom research.
- Miranda Wells: Miranda turns Scarlett from a powerful but socially dangerous young ruler into someone able to operate among people. Scarlett treats her as an elder and later answers her request to intervene against a hidden B-grade enemy.
- Draskil: Draskil finds Scarlett attractive and repeatedly pushes a flirtatious approach. She rejects him physically and decisively, though they can still operate on the same battlefield.
